They finally did it. After much rumor and speculation, Google has released their own web browser. Google Chrome, now available for Windows, and soon Mac and Linux, is designed to be the browser for the modern day, or something of the sort. It's lightweight, it uses little RAM, and it's got a quick JavaScript engine. It's interface is pretty unique too. Gonna have to try it for myself later...
